[embed]https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=6iAoDIdiANs&t=171s[/embed]   An unprecedented series of interest rate hikes have precipitated fears of a debt crisis in a world addicted to cheap money for 20 years. · The world has added more than $50 trillion to its debt since 2018. · As interest rates rise, while economic growth slumps, it is becoming harder for household, companies and even nations to pay interest on loans and borrow anew. · Worth watching our video “Special: Global Debt Crisis Beckoning!” to put things in context.
  • Emerging Markets, including Turkey are primate candidates for debt crises.
  • Is Turkey headed for a debt crisis?
  • Real Turkey Channel argues that Turkey could witness not ONE, but three sequential debt crises.
